William Graves Jr (1811-1877) was a ship master and owner from Newburyport, Massachusetts. He was also involved in local politics, serving as alderman and mayor. His brother Alexander (1823-1869) was also a ship master and owner. Another brother, Edward (1831-1873) was lost at sea while aboard the Tennyson.
